Toby powered grass campsite
Liked: EVERYTHING! The owners were friendly but not in your face, they were available if needed, they were helpful and take great pride in their space. You can tell how much love and effort they have put into making it a great place for adults to come and truly relax.. from chicken and duck eggs, to a solar powered shower for sunny days and gas ones for others.. to free fire pits and wood for an evening fire..to a lovely decking area kitted out with tables, chairs, beanbags and a bbq which you're welcome to use. If you need any help to do with camping there, they are more than willing. My plug extension didn't quite reach and Richard quickly came to the rescue with a solution. It's a small site with a good space between pitches and little plant fences between each pitch giving a little extra privacy. It was a perfect stay and I will definitely go back.. 100% would recommend this site. Thank you Karen and Richard. Ohhhh and actual wifi connection if needed!

Tallulah 1 bedroom on-site travel trailer
Liked: The caravan was immaculately clean as were the facilities on site. Lovely location in gorgeous countryside and only a few minutes drive to pubs and the town of Tenterden.
Disliked: The hot water in the caravan worked intermittently and l had to have two cold showers and wash in freezing cold water throughout our stay. This was very unpleasant particularly as it was cold outside. We were not given full instructions as to how to problem solve issues and only received half a sheet of instructions. On one of the evenings we struggled to get the heating to work and there was no one around to ask.
We were asked to leave the caravan as we found it but there wasn't a dustpan and brush or vacuum cleaner so ended up trying to hand pick bits off the carpet. On our arrival the gas had run out so had to find the owner who replaced it..Asked for the password for the Internet and was told several times that it was on the information sheet we had been given. It transpired that we had not been given the other half of the instructions. Would have been nice if the owner realising his mistake bought us the full set as we may have been able to problem solve the heating / hot water issue. Would have given a higher rating if it hadn't been for this.
